Backpacking Afternoon

Photo info: FUJIFILM X100T, 19mm, f/7.1, 1/150 sec, ISO200
“Big Pack” Marble Falls, 2019

I hit the trail today with an almost-fully-loaded backpack (only missing food and clothes) to test out my set up. The backpack was comfortable and I worked out a few things, including how to carry my camera and if I prefer hiking with one or two trekking poles (single is better). In addition, my 700 ml bottle on the shoulder strap works great! I’m happy the water bottle sleeve I picked up from Daiso will see service. 😊

Trail Caffeine

Photo info: FUJIFILM X100T, 19mm, f/4, 1/60 sec, ISO6400
“Camp Coffee” Cedar Park, 2019

I bought these instant coffee packets at the supermarket today. Each box cost less than a dollar, whereas if you buy “backpacking coffee”, you’ll be paying over a dollar per packet. Granted, the backpacking coffee is supposed to be much tastier, the price is over my threshold. 😄
